Abstract
The transient response, under the circumstances of phase-frequency manipulated signal effects on a high-frequency differential link, realized in the form of a sixth order rejection filter, have been investigated. Analytic expressions, describing changes in output signal amplitude and phase, have been obtained. An example of the obtained results is shown.
